Training for TheatreDateline: 30th July, 2000
Recently I've had a flood of email enquiries, many from Americans, about drama training in the UK. I suppose it's the time of year, when 16 and 18 year-olds consider their future careers. So perhaps now is a suitable time to outline the drama training set-up in the UK.
The first thing to be aware of is that anyone can set themselves up as a drama school. Unlike for private schools for children up to the age of 18, there is no requirement for drama schools to be in any way inspected, accredited or approved by the Department for Education. This means that those wishing to go to a drama school must exercise care, making sure that the school in which they are interested is actually capable of delivering good training and, most importantly, is able to help them get started in the business after they leave.
